The Milford Police Department has released radio transmissions from the night when one of its officers was involved in an accident that killed two teenagers over the summer.
The crash happened at around 2:15 a.m. June 13 on Boston Post Road in Orange, where investigators say Officer Jason Anderson's cruiser collided with the car carrying Ashlie Krakowski and David Servin, both 19 years old.
Both teenagers died after being ejected from their vehicle, and Anderson was severely injured. State police are still trying to determine who is responsible for the deadly crash.
Authorities are expected to release their report on the accident within a month.
